Transaction 434426360d0de5e8f57b7cb134f132b5886349a4e8b82ce19f79b3d27fbef504
1 Input
1 Output
-
434426360d0de5e8f57b7cb134f132b5886349a4e8b82ce19f79b3d27fbef504:0
- value
- 449598
- script pubkey
- OP_0 OP_PUSHBYTES_20 8089c4981e530c29943bd80e10ea206b0db965f0
- address
- bc1qszyufxq72vxzn9pmmq8pp63qdvxmje0smw2aaj